The science behind fast charging revolves around the principles of electricity, voltage, and battery chemistry. Fast charging technology is designed to pump more current into a battery than traditional chargers, which ultimately reduces charging time. This is achieved through various methods, such as adjusting the voltage and current levels or using special charging protocols that manage the flow of energy more effectively. For instance, many smartphones and electric vehicles utilize smart charging systems that communicate with the charger to ensure optimal charging rates and prevent overheating.

In today's fast-paced world, the demand for fast charging technologies is at an all-time high. With the proliferation of smartphones, electric vehicles, and other portable devices, manufacturers are continually innovating to reduce charging times. Among the leading technologies making waves are Qualcomm Quick Charge, which allows compatible devices to charge up to 75% faster than conventional methods, and USB Power Delivery, providing higher wattage for faster charging across various device types. Some other notable mentions include the Samsung Adaptive Fast Charging and OPPO VOOC Charge, each designed to optimize power delivery while preserving battery health.
Understanding these fast charging technologies can significantly enhance your device experience. For instance, Super Charge Technology (SCT) from Huawei claims to fully charge a smartphone in just 30 minutes, while Apple's Fast Charge feature promises to increase charging speed for compatible iPhone users when combined with a USB-C power adapter. As these technologies continue to evolve, it's essential to stay informed about which are available for your devices to maximize convenience and efficiency. In today’s fast-paced digital world, having a device that supports fast charging can significantly enhance your productivity. However, understanding fast charging compatibility is crucial to ensure that you are making the most of this technology. Not all smartphones, tablets, or laptops are created equal when it comes to fast charging capabilities. Manufacturers often implement different protocols such as Quick Charge, USB Power Delivery, and proprietary systems, which can lead to confusion for consumers. Before investing in a new charger or cable, check the specifications of your device to confirm whether it supports fast charging and which protocols are compatible.
To determine if your device is compatible with fast charging technology, consider the following factors: 1. The device model—Make sure to verify the fast charging capabilities listed by the manufacturer. 2. The charger type—Even if your device supports fast charging, using a charger that doesn't meet the required specifications will not yield the expected results. 3. The cable used—High-quality cables that support the needed voltage and current ratings are essential for effective fast charging. Being knowledgeable about these components can help you maximize your device’s performance and ensure a seamless charging experience.
